Installation Steps for the Canon PIXMA MX439 Driver on Windows
- Locate the downloaded installer file on your computer, typically found in the Downloads folder.
- Run the installer executable by double-clicking the .exe file.
- Accept any User Account Control (UAC) prompts that may appear on your screen.
- Follow the on-screen prompts to proceed through the installation wizard, accepting the license agreement.
- During installation, you may need to configure printer ports and settings in the Device Manager.
- Wait for the installation to complete and, if prompted, restart your computer for the changes to take effect.
- After the restart, add the Canon PIXMA MX439 to your printer settings via the Control Panel or Settings app.
Installing the Canon PIXMA MX439 Driver on macOS
- Open the downloaded .dmg or .pkg file from your Downloads folder.
- Follow the prompts in the installer to initiate the installation process.
- Grant any necessary permissions for System Extensions if prompted during installation.
- Review and accept the license agreement to proceed.
- Connect the printer as instructed, selecting it from the Printers & Scanners menu once the installation is complete.
- Optionally restart your Mac if you encounter any issues after installation.
- Once reconnected, verify that the printer is functioning correctly by printing a test page.

Fixing Canon PIXMA MX439 Driver Problems
Users may occasionally experience challenges with the Canon PIXMA MX439 driver. Common issues like connectivity problems, print quality degradation, or error messages can often be resolved through simple troubleshooting steps. Restarting the printer and computer can often clear transient issues. It’s also advisable to check the cable connections if using a wired setup or the Wi-Fi settings for wireless configurations.
- Check Connectivity: Ensure that the printer is connected to the correct network.
- Update Software: Ensure you are running the latest version of the PIXMA MX439 driver.
- Consult User Manuals: Refer to the user manual for specific error code troubleshooting.
Taking these steps can mitigate most issues, allowing you to maintain productivity and minimize downtime with your printer.
